如何用chat gpt深度学习,深度学习是什么
如何用chat gpt深度学习
要使用ChatGPT进行深度学习,首先需要明确ChatGPT本身就是一个基于深度学习的自然语言处理模型。然而,当我们谈论“用ChatGPT进行深度学习”时,可能指的是如何利用ChatGPT的深度学习能力和技术原理来进一步开发或优化相关应用。以下是一些关键步骤和考虑因素:### 1. 理解ChatGPT的基本原理
* 模型架构:ChatGPT采用了Transformer架构,这是一种基于自注意力机制的神经网络结构,特别适用于处理自然语言任务(来源:百度开发者中心)。
* 训练过程:ChatGPT通过训练大量的文本数据来学习语言模式和规律,并使用强化学习算法优化模型性能(来源:百度开发者中心)。
### 2. 准备适合的数据集
* 数据集的选择对模型的训练和生成效果至关重要。应该选择大规模、多样化的数据集,以确保模型能够学习到丰富的语言知识和模式。
* 数据集可以包含问题和回答的对话样本,也可以是其他类型的文本数据。
### 3. 定制和优化模型
* 微调(Fine-tuning):根据具体任务需求,对ChatGPT模型进行微调,以提升模型在特定领域或任务上的性能。
* 优化策略:调整模型的超参数(如学习率、批量大小、隐藏层大小等),以及训练策略(如增加训练数据、调整模型结构等),以优化模型的生成效果和性能。
### 4. 集成到应用中
* 将训练好的ChatGPT模型集成到具体的应用中,如智能客服、智能助手、教育平台等。
* 使用API接口将模型部署到服务器上,以实现在线的对话服务。
### 5. 监控和优化
* 在模型部署后,定期收集用户反馈和评价,了解模型的表现和问题。
* 根据反馈进行模型的调整和优化,以提供更好的用户体验。
### 6. 利用ChatGPT的深度学习技术原理进行开发
* 学习Transformer架构:深入研究Transformer架构的原理和实现方式,以便在开发其他深度学习模型时能够借鉴和应用。
* 探索强化学习:了解强化学习算法在深度学习中的应用,尝试将强化学习与其他技术结合,以开发出更智能、更高效的模型。
### 7. 实际应用案例
* 论文写作辅助:利用ChatGPT的生成能力,辅助完成论文的摘要、综述等部分,提高写作效率和质量(来源:知乎专栏)。
* 编程助手:使用ChatGPT进行代码讲解、纠错及自动修改,帮助开发者提高编程效率(来源:知乎专栏)。
综上所述,要用ChatGPT进行深度学习,首先需要理解其基本原理和训练过程,然后准备适合的数据集,对模型进行定制和优化,并将其集成到具体的应用中。同时,还可以利用ChatGPT的深度学习技术原理进行更广泛的开发和应用。
深度学习是什么
当然,以下是一个模拟网友针对“深度学习是什么”话题的专业、详细回复:---
深度学习是什么?
深度学习(Deep Learning)作为机器学习的一个分支,近年来在人工智能领域取得了显著的进展和广泛的应用。简单来说,深度学习是一种通过构建深层神经网络模型来学习数据的特征表示和模式识别的算法。这种算法能够自动地从大量数据中提取出复杂且抽象的特征,进而实现对新数据的分类、识别、回归等任务。
### 一、深度学习的核心特点
1. 多层非线性处理:深度学习模型通常由多个层次组成,每个层次都包含多个神经元,通过非线性激活函数连接。这种多层结构使得模型能够学习到数据的层次化特征,从低级的边缘、纹理到高级的语义信息。
2. 自动特征提取:与传统的机器学习方法需要手动设计特征不同,深度学习能够自动地从原始数据中提取出有效的特征表示,极大地减轻了人工干预的负担。
3. 大数据驱动:深度学习模型的表现高度依赖于训练数据的质量和数量。大数据集使得模型能够学习到更加复杂和泛化的特征,从而提高模型的准确性和鲁棒性。
### 二、深度学习的基本原理
深度学习通过构建深层神经网络模型,利用反向传播算法(Backpropagation)来优化网络参数。在训练过程中,模型会不断地调整其内部参数(如权重和偏置),以最小化预测结果与真实结果之间的误差(即损失函数)。这一过程通过梯度下降等优化算法实现,使得模型能够逐渐逼近最优解。
### 三、深度学习的应用领域
由于深度学习强大的特征提取和模式识别能力,它已经被广泛应用于多个领域,包括但不限于:
1. 计算机视觉:如图像分类、物体检测、人脸识别等。
2. 自然语言处理:如机器翻译、文本分类、情感分析等。
3. 语音识别与合成:如语音转文本、语音生成等。
4. 推荐系统:根据用户的行为和兴趣推荐相关内容。
5. 医疗健康:如医学影像分析、基因组学分析等。
6. 自动驾驶:感知环境、决策和控制车辆以实现安全自动驾驶。
### 四、深度学习的优缺点
优点:
1. 学习能力强:能够自动从数据中学习复杂的特征表示。
2. 适应性好:能够解决多种复杂的任务和问题。
3. 数据驱动:表现高度依赖于数据的质量和数量,上限高。
缺点:
1. 计算量大:需要大量的计算资源和时间来训练模型。
2. 硬件需求高:对GPU等高性能硬件有较高要求。
3. 模型设计复杂:需要专业的知识和经验来设计有效的模型结构。
4. 可解释性差:模型的决策过程往往难以被人类理解。
综上所述,深度学习是一种强大的机器学习技术,它通过构建深层神经网络模型来自动学习数据的特征表示和模式识别,已经在多个领域取得了显著的成果。然而,深度学习也面临着计算量大、硬件需求高、模型设计复杂等挑战。随着技术的不断进步和发展,我们有理由相信深度学习将在未来发挥更加重要的作用。